Choicely is a fast-growing Helsinki-based technology startup that has developed a revolutionary no-code app builder platform.
We serve world-class clients in the fields of media, sports and entertainment across 6 different continents. Over 80% of our revenue comes from clients outside of Finland.
Role Overview
We are seeking a skilled and motivated AI Developer to join our backend team. The ideal candidate will have experience building and deploying AI/ML models in cloud environments, particularly using Google Cloud AI tools. This is an on-site role, and applicants must be comfortable with in-person collaboration and hands-on development.
Key Responsibilities:
- Design, develop, and deploy AI/ML models
- Integrate AI capabilities into existing backend architectures
- Optimize data pipelines and preprocessing workflows for machine learning models
- Collaborate closely with backend engineers
- Monitor, evaluate, and improve model performance
Requirements
Technical skills
- Proficiency in Python and experience with backend frameworks like Flask or FastAPI
- Strong understanding of machine learning algorithms and frameworks like TensorFlow, PyTorch, or Scikit-learn
- Proficient in designing and managing APIs and microservices architectures
- Skills to manage cloud-native systems and knowledge of Docker for containerized deployments
- Experience with SQL/NoSQL databases and data processing tools (e.g., BigQuery)
Additional skills
- Strong problem-solving abilities and debugging skills
- Experience working with version control systems (Git + GitHub/GitLab)
- Comfortable working with large datasets
- Knowledge of DevOps practices and system monitoring tools
Preferred qualifications
- Hands-on experience with Google Cloud AI tools (Vertex AI, AutoML, AI Platform, etc.) is preferred
- Google Cloud certifications related to AI/ML or Cloud Engineering
- Prior experience with natural language processing (NLP) or computer vision projects
- Contributions to open-source AI projects or public code repositories
Interview Process
We prioritize technical skill assessment and team collaboration. Selected candidates will:
- Participate in a live coding session during the interview to demonstrate problem-solving and coding ability
- Engage in a technical discussion about AI implementation approaches
Application Requirements
Apply by filling out the form below by January 31, 2025 the latest. We are interviewing candidates throughout the application period. We will fill the role as soon as we find the right candidate.
Applicants should include:
- A resume or a CV describing relevant experience and passion for AI development
- A portfolio link or GitHub repository showcasing AI/ML projects
Within these documents applicants are encouraged to include:
- Examples of previous work demonstrating the use of Google Cloud AI tools
- Details of any Google Cloud certifications (if applicable)